About Converting Megagrams per Cup to Slugs per Cubic Meter
Megagram per Cup and Slug per Cubic Meter both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.
Formula
slugs per cubic meter = megagrams per cup × 289624.568282
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 megagram per cup equals 4226752.83773 base units, and 1 slug per cubic meter equals 14.5939029372 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ct megagram per cup-to-slug per cubic meter factor of 289624.568282.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?
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
